메뉴 닫기

BGP조정 ACL 표현식

1.프리픽스 리스트(prefix-list)
엑세스 리스트를 개선하여 만든것이며, BGP뿐만 아니라 모든 라우팅 프로토콜에서 정책설정을 위한

대상 네트워크를 지정할때 사용한다.

해당 경로를 검색하는 시간이 빠르고, 내용의 일부를 지우거나 추가할 수 있다.

– 네트워크 옵션 : len < ge <= le <= 32

0.0.0.0/0 : 디폴트 루트

0.0.0.0/0 le 32 : 모든 네트워크

0.0.0.0/0 ge 8 le 24 : 서브넷 마스크 길이가 8 이상 24 이하인 모든 네트워크

ge 24 : ge(greater or equal) 지정하는 길이 이상의 서브넷, 24부터 32비트까지 서브넷 마스크

10.1.1.0/16 le 24 : le(less or equal) 지정하는 길이 이하의 서브넷, 16부터 24비트까지 서브넷 마스크

1.1.0.0/16 ge 24 le 24 : 1.1/16네트워크 중에서 서브넷 마스크 길이가 정확히 24비트인 네트워크,

즉, 1.1.0.0/24 부터 1.1.255.0/24 네트워크 256개를 의미한다.

 

2. AS 경로 access list

특정 AS번호를 지정할 때 사용한다. AS경로 액세스 리스트를 만들 때는 레귤러 익스프레션(regular expression)

또는 줄여서 레직스(regix)라고 하는 표현 방식을 사용한다.

@정규식의 예

. : 임의의 single 문자

* : 0번 이상 반복

+ : 1번 이상 반복

? : 1번 이하 반복

[] : 한 문자의 범위를 지정

– : 한 문자의 범위를 지정할 때 시작과 끝을 분리

^ : 문자열의 시작

$ : 문자열의 끝

_ : 쉼표, {.}.(.),^,$, 공백

@ 사용예

^$ : 자신의 AS에서 발생한 것

^100$ : 100에서 시작하고 100에서 끝나는것 즉. 100

^100 : 100으로 시작하는 것들 : 100, 100 200, 100 200 300 …

100$ : 100으로 끝나는 것들 : 100, 200 100, 300 200 100 …

100 : 100이 포함된 것들 : 100, 100 200, 200 100, 300 100 200 …

_100_ : ^100, ^100$, 100$, 100 등을 모두 포함한 것들

1.2 : 112, 122, 132 등

1* : 공란, 1, 11, 111, 1111….

(12)* : 공란, 12, 1212, 121212…

[1-3]4 : 14, 24, 34

 

[polldaddy rating=”7739789″]

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 항목은 *(으)로 표시합니다